Defining Made to Measure Matting

Custom made mats are designed around exact measurements.
They differ from standard sizes sold off the shelf.

Each mat matches the space provided.
The mat works as intended.

Custom Mat Material Options

Bespoke mats can be made from many materials.
Coir, textile, rubber, and aluminium systems are common.
